
Information Security Governance Manager

BHG Financial
Summary
Join BHG Financial, an award-winning company with a focus on productivity and developing employees into business leaders. The company offers leading-edge financial solutions and personalized concierge service to professionals and businesses. They are seeking a motivated Information Security (IS) professional passionate about governance to mature and manage their IS Governance Program. This role involves defining and implementing data governance policies, leading initiatives to reduce risks, and enhancing an AI governance framework. The ideal candidate will have 6+ years of experience in IS, a Bachelor’s degree in a related field, relevant certifications, and expert knowledge of IS frameworks and AI regulations. Responsibilities
- Mature and manage the IS Governance Program by collaborating with multiple stakeholders to ensure BHG’s IS security governance strategies, policies, and procedures align with business objectives, mitigate risks, and comply with regulatory requirements
- Define, implement, and enforce data governance policies, standards, and procedures to ensure the accuracy, completeness, and timeliness of data across all systems and processes
- Manage data governance and data quality issues and collaborate with business units and Product and Technology (P&T) to ensure that data related business requirements are clearly defined, communicated, and understood ensuring operational effectiveness
- Lead initiatives to reduce data governance risks, as well as support the cultural shift toward active data governance and ownership
- In collaboration with key stakeholders, enhance and implement a comprehensive, efficient Artificial Intelligence (AI) governance framework, including policies, procedures, standards and best practices
- Manage the development and maintenance of IS policies, standards, and procedures
- Manage the maintenance and enhancement of existing security awareness program, including monthly and targeted security awareness trainings and phishing campaigns and collecting data for analysis and improving security posture
- Collaborate and build relationships with cross-functional teams, including, but not limited to P&T, Legal, Enterprise Compliance, Regulatory Relations, and business stakeholders to implement IS governance requirements
- Improve IS reporting and metrics for leadership and board of directors
- Chair and maintain relevant IT and IS Governance Committees (such as IT Steering Committee)
- Stay updated on industry trends, technologies, and regulations related to IS governance
- Assist in design and implementation of automated processes and Governance, Risk, and Compliance (GRC) toolsets (such as OneTrust, Zilla, OvalEdge, etc.)
- Manage a team of governance professionals and promoting individual career development and training
